Message type: E = Error
Message class: PLM_FMEA_APPL - FMEA - Message
Message number: 207
Message text: Function &1 does not have any defects that have links to &2 of FMEA &3

PLM_FMEA_APPL207
- Function &1 does not have any defects that have links to &2 of FMEA &3 ?The SAP error message PLM_FMEA_APPL207 indicates that a specific function (denoted as &1) in a Failure Mode and Effects Analysis (FMEA) does not have any defects linked to it for the specified FMEA (denoted as &3) and the specific link type (denoted as &2). This error typically arises in the context of FMEA management within SAP PLM (Product Lifecycle Management).
Cause:
- No Linked Defects: The primary cause of this error is that the function you are trying to access does not have any associated defects. This could happen if defects were not created or linked properly to the function in the FMEA.
- Incorrect Configuration: There may be an issue with the configuration of the FMEA or the way the functions and defects are set up in the system.
- Data Integrity Issues: There could be data integrity issues where the expected links between functions and defects are missing or have been deleted.
Solution:
- Check Function and Defects: Verify that the function (&1) you are referencing actually has defects linked to it. You can do this by navigating to the FMEA and checking the associated defects.
- Create or Link Defects: If there are no defects linked to the function, you will need to create new defects or link existing defects to the function. Ensure that the defects are properly assigned to the correct FMEA and function.
-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ings for the FMEA process in SAP to ensure that everything is set up correctly. This includes checking the link types and ensuring that they are correctly defined.
- Data Consistency Check: Perform a data consistency check to identify any discrepancies in the FMEA data. This can help in identifying any missing links or data integrity issues.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for specific guidance on managing FMEA and defects within your version of SAP PLM.
